Synopsis

When the king announces that whoever travels his highway the best will be the next king, a young shepherd boy learns that he does not have to be of noble blood to perform noble acts and possess noble virtues.

About the Author

Howard W. Fullmer was born in Hawaii but raised on a very small ranch in Idaho. He has illustrated for such magazines as Bicycling and Outdoor Life and illustrated for companies including United Parcel Service and IBM. This is his first picture book. He lives with his wife and three children, one dog, and several cats in Springville, Utah. When he s not illustrating, Howard loves spending time snow skiing and camping with his family.

From the Inside Flap

The well-known fable The King's Highway has inspired readers for generations. In this new retelling, artist Howeard Fullmer makes it his own through his stunning, full-color illustrations and revised text. Readers will discover the story of a king who must choose as heir to the throne.
